The 2006 Derbi DRD Edition 50 SM represents a key offering in the 50cc supermoto segment, a category popular with younger riders and those seeking an agile, lightweight machine for urban and light off-road use. This model builds on Derbi’s established reputation for producing capable small-displacement motorcycles, offering a sporty aesthetic and practical performance. In its competitive landscape, the DRD Edition 50 SM would have been frequently compared to models like the Aprilia SX 50 and the Rieju MRT 50 SM, all vying for the attention of riders entering the motorcycle world.
At the heart of the DRD Edition 50 SM is a 49.90 ccm (3.04 cubic inches) single-cylinder engine. This two-stroke powerplant is designed for responsiveness and efficiency within its displacement class, providing sufficient power for its intended purpose. While not built for high-speed cruising, the engine delivers lively acceleration for navigating city traffic and tackling twisty backroads. The supermoto configuration, with its smaller wheels and road-biased tires, complements the engine's output by maximizing agility and handling, making the most of every cubic inch.
Categorized as an "Allround" motorcycle, the DRD Edition 50 SM offers a versatile riding experience. Its supermoto styling translates to an upright riding position, which is comfortable for extended periods and provides excellent visibility in traffic. The suspension, while not overly complex, is tuned to absorb urban imperfections and provide predictable handling on various surfaces. Its lightweight nature makes it easy to maneuver, instilling confidence in new riders while still being engaging enough for those with more experience. The ergonomics are generally user-friendly, allowing riders to feel connected to the machine.
The Derbi DRD Edition 50 SM 2006 primarily targets young riders, particularly those in European markets where 50cc motorcycles are a popular entry point into motorcycling. It also appeals to individuals seeking an economical and fun commuter bike with a distinctive supermoto flair. Its robust build quality for the class and accessible performance make it a sensible choice for those looking for an engaging and practical small-displacement motorcycle. The DRD Edition 50 SM remains a respected option within its niche for its blend of style and functional capability.
